Ver por etiquetas

Todas las etiquetas » Rapitools (RSS)

Descargar masivamente las presentaciones del MIX 2010

Hace algunos meses hice una aplicación para descargar las sesiones del PDC 2009 . Y los objetivos eran básicamente dos: Descargar archivos masivamente que tengan un patrón de nombres en común. No sólo que me sirva para el PDC o el MIX, si no para cualquier descarga de archivos basada en un patrón de nombres. Mostrar algunas ventajas del despliegue ClickOnce . En las anteriores versiones no habilite las actualizaciones automáticas, pero en la última...
Publicado por Sergio Tarrillo | 6 comment(s)

analizando codigo maleado?, tienes que usar NDepend

Entiéndase código maleado, a aquel código que todos los miran pero nadie lo quiere tocar, aquel código en el que actualizas un método, y te das cuenta que tienes que actualizar más del 60% de la aplicación. El análisis de código, puede ser para entender la arquitectura de una aplicación en particular, para hacer un code review , o para refactorizar proyectos con código maleado . Para revisar código, y analizar la implementación del mismo podemos usar Reflector , podemos saber que métodos dependen...
Publicado por Sergio Tarrillo | 2 comment(s)
Archivado en: ,,

Smart Code Generator…. desde ASP.NET

Nuevamente en Lima y con nuevo trabajo laburo, curro, tengo que terminar una aplicación que está al 80%, y da mucha lata pereza hacer código tradicional (creación de entidades, de clases de acceso a datos, etc) Bajo demanda (ósea cuando los necesite), iré revisando los diversos generadores de código existentes. Smart Code Generator , es un generador de código a nivel de clases, que tiene como front-end una aplicación Web ASP.NET (VS2005, VS2008). Desde una página Web nosotros podemos generar archivos...

LDLS: ASP.NET y mas...

[LDLS] -> Links de la semana. Y es que a veces se leen muchos recursos en el RSS, que se lo deja como pendiente en los drafts del Writer , y casi nunca llegan a ser públicos. Es por eso que ahora tratare de hacer una lista de links de la semana, que por cuestiones de tiempo no se puede postear cada una a detalle. Algunos links son de novedades, otros de algunos artículos que he llegado y me han parecido interesantes. Por cierto no revisen todas las entradas, sólo las que necesiten...

antes de perder la esperanza, usar Process Monitor :D

Y es que a veces hay momentos, que ni el chapulín colorado te salva la razón de algunos problemas es muy difícil detectar. Lo primero es revisar el Event Viewer (visor de eventos), pero si no hay nada ahí, que hacemos?, como detectar el origen del problema? Por ejemplo hago "View in Browser", en VS2005 o VS2008, y obtengo el siguiente mensaje: Internet Explorer cannot display the webpage    Most likely causes: You are not connected to the Internet. The website...
Publicado por Sergio Tarrillo | con no comments

Fiddler herramienta de bolsillo para depurar trafico HTTP y mas...

¿De que me puede servir depurar tráfico http?. Veamos: Podemos ver que llamadas a recursos no tienen respuesta, (pusiste elementos img, pero te olvidaste de subir las imágenes al server :S). Pero quizás la principal feature es ver a detalle el request y response. En la imagen para el request seleccionado, vemos cuantos bytes son enviados al servidor, y cuantos bytes recibimos del servidor. Esto nos puede ayudar sobretodo, cuando estamos buscando opciones de performance, con esto podemos ver a detalle...

Reflector, chiquito pero poderoso

Reflector es una herramienta que existe desde hace años, y que llega a formar parte de las herramientas básicas de un dev.Net. Voy a mostrar la herramienta, para los que no la conocen aún, y dar otros detalles. Además que piensa usar Reflector en otras entradas. Primero vemos el siguiente gráfico: Cada vez que hacemos un Build, lo que hace VS es generar un *.exe en caso de aplicaciones ejecutables, *.ddl en caso de librerías. Pero en si estos ensamblados, no son programas que puedan correr por si...
Publicado por Sergio Tarrillo | 1 comment(s)
Archivado en: ,,

Colorea tu codigo en Windows Live Writer

Hace unos meses había comentado la liberación de Windows Live Writer Beta 2 , pues me enteré de un plugin para colorear el código: Code Snippet plugin for Windows Live Writer : La use en este post , y me ha dejado satisfecho. Antes el código que usaba en el blog a lo mucho lo que hacía, era identarlo y ponerlo de un sólo color. Pero con esta herramienta, puedes un código más agradable, y de más fácil lectura, sobretodo sin esfuerzo mayor que unos clics, y usar el clipboard :). Algunas de las features...
Publicado por Sergio Tarrillo | 4 comment(s)
Archivado en: ,

Windows Live Writer Beta 2

Hace unas semanas se liberó Windows Live Writer Beta 2 , lo pueden descargar desde el siguiente link . Ya hace meses habías calmado la sed de postear con la versión anterior de Windows Live Writer . En el anunció de la nueva versión se mencionan varias features, como la del corrector ortográfico, que no encuentro como habilitarlo, o será sólo para el idioma ingles?, bueno igual lo corrijo copiando al word, otra feature que mencionan es la habilidad de agregar categorías desde la misma herramienta...
Publicado por Sergio Tarrillo | 3 comment(s)
Archivado en: ,,

SQL Server Hosting Toolkit 1.0 en espaniol

En un post pasado, hablábamos de como generar automáticamente archivos *.sql para subir a nuestro hosting , usando la herramienta SQL Server Hosting Toolkit . A una semanas de ese post, recién me entero ya que no le seguí el rastro, fue liberado la versión final 1.0 , que antes era RC. Entre las novedades de la versión 1.0, es que ahora hay soporte para el idioma español desde el siguiente link: Microsoft SQL Server Database Publishing Wizard 1.0 (español) , además que también podemos descargar la...

y es que no siempre, todo es color de rosa

Leía el post de Eugenio : Refactor!™ for ASP.NET (descarga gratuita cuando se redacto este post), e inmediatamente vi el video tutorial . Y solamente quedo decir: que loko!, que tal refactoring . Particularmente me intereso el poder extraer el CSS tanto de etiquetas HTML como el de los controles ASP.NET: También me agrado el poder usarlo con el reciente liberado ASP.NET AJAX , facilitando el poder agregar cierto contenido dentro de un UpdatePanel : Lo de extraer un ContentPlaceHolder y crear una...

Internet Explorer Developer Toolbar Beta 3

En Jul/2006, Cristian Manteiga , había anunciado Internet Explorer Developer Toolbar Beta 2 . Pues contarles que ya esta disponible la versión Beta 3 . En el post de Cristian, pueden encontrar los detalles de esta barra, además en el blog del Team de Intener Explorer también le dedican un post a la Beta 3 . Por eso ya no comentaré los detalles, pero si dejaré mi cosecha, en imágenes: Este es el toolbar y sus menús: Podemos seleccionar elementos haciendo clic en ellos, sólo tenemos que pasar el mouse...
Publicado por Sergio Tarrillo | 7 comment(s)
Archivado en: ,

Generando automaticamente archivos *.sql para subir a nuestro hosting

Este post va ser un poco rápido sin entrar en detalles, y no voy a hacer un howto, salvo que los comentarios lo ameriten. Al grano, el caso es el siguiente: normalmente para subir nuestras aplicaciones web a nuestro hosting contamos un FTP para lograr ello. Pero que pasa cuando queremos subir nuestra base de datos ¿?. Si quieren subir su site local a la web, http://www.vwdhosting.net/ , nos da hosting gratuito por 30 días, pero tenemos ASP.NET 2.0 y SQL Server. Es una gran oportunidad para subir...

Rapitools: Generar Procedimientos Almacenados (insert, update, etc)

Los Procedimientos Almacenados como insertar, actualizar, eliminar, seleccionar todos los campos, hasta las busquedas genéricas, son tareas clásicas y que siempre debemos realizar en un sistema transaccional. Imagenemos que tenemos tablas de 20 columnas a más, que es lo mas común en un sistema real, y tener que estar haciendo los procedimientos tomará cierto tiempo, con el tiempo te puedes mecanizar o copiar más rápido, por ejemplo los variables declaradas en el Store Procedure de Insertar lo puedes...
Publicado por Sergio Tarrillo | 4 comment(s)

Rapitools: Tool para generar codigo C# a partir de Procedimientos Almacenados!

Con este post, damos inicia a esta nueva categoría: Rapitools. En la cual postearemos todo el tipo de herramientas que me parescan útililes para aumentar la productividad del desarrollador (auque algunos las llaman herramientas para haraganes ). Recordarles que estas herramientas son de externos, por lo tanto, el autor no se responsabiliza si alguna herramienta no satisface todas las necesidades de los que las usan. Y bla, bla,....., ahora a la herramienta de este post: Con esta herramientas, en...
Publicado por Sergio Tarrillo | 4 comment(s)

Rapitools: Convertir codigo C# a VB.Net y viceversa

Si es que les gusto el rapitool anterior, pero quieren el código en VB.NET, pues tienen convertidores de codigo: online y offline: Convertidor online: Url : DeveloperFusion - http://www.developerfusion.co.uk/utilities/convertcsharptovb.aspx Funciones : Convierte porciones de codigo C# a VB.NET y codigo VB.NET a C# Convertidor offline: Url : MSDN Magazine - http://msdn.microsoft.com/msdnmag/issues/06/02/PasteAs/ Funciones : Convierte codigo C# a VB.NET Tipo : Add-in, "Paste as Visual Basic" Descarga...
Publicado por Sergio Tarrillo | 14 comment(s)
Archivado en: ,,